Exports by Country
Mauritius was the largest exporting country with an export of about X tons, which resulted at X% of total exports. Botswana (X tons) ranks second in terms of the total exports with a X% share, followed by South Africa (X%).
Exports from Mauritius increased at an average annual rate of X% from 2012 to 2022. At the same time, Botswana (X%) and South Africa (X%) displayed positive paces of growth. Moreover, Botswana emerged as the fastest-growing exporter exported in SADC, with a CAGR of X% from 2012-2022. From 2012 to 2022, the share of Mauritius and Botswana increased by X and X percentage points, respectively.
In value terms, South Africa ($X) remains the largest antisera supplier in SADC, comprising X%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was held by Mauritius ($X), with an X% share of total exports.
From 2012 to 2022, the average annual growth rate of value in South Africa totaled X%. The remaining exporting countries rec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: Mauritius (X% per year) and Botswana (X% per year).

Imports by Country
In 2022, Angola (X tons) was the key importer of antisera and other blood fractions, comprising X% of total imports. South Africa (X tons) took the second position in the ranking, distantly followed by Mozambique (X tons). All these countries together took near X% share of total imports. Malawi (X tons) followed a long way behind the leaders.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of purchases, amongst the leading importing countries, was attained by Mozambique (with a CAGR of X%), while imports for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
In value terms, South Africa ($X) constitutes the largest market for imported antisera and other blood fractions in SADC, comprising X%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was taken by Angola ($X), with a X% share of total imports. It was followed by Mozambique, with a X% share.
In South Africa, antisera imports expanded at an average annual rate of X% over the period from 2012-2022. In the other countries, the average annual rates were as follows: Angola (X% per year) and Mozambique (X% per year).
